Temporal Knowledge Graph Reasoning with Dynamic Hypergraph Embedding (2024.lrec-main)

Copied to clipboard

Challenge: Existing models that model temporal dynamics with knowledge graphs and graph convolution networks lack high-order interactions between objects in TKG, which is an important factor to predict future facts.
Approach: They propose to embed temporal knowledge graph reasoning by constructing hypergraphs based on temporal information graphs at different timestamps and then adapt dynamic meta-embedding to fit TKG.
Outcome: The proposed method outperforms baseline models on public TKG datasets and provides good interpretation for the predicted results.

Unsupervised Concept Representation Learning for Length-Varying Text Similarity (2021.naacl-main)

Copied to clipboard

Challenge: Existing document similarity approaches suffer from the information gap caused by context and vocabulary mismatches when comparing varying-length texts.
Approach: They propose an unsupervised concept representation learning approach to address this issue . they propose a concept-based document matching method to leverage recognition of local phrase features .
Outcome: The proposed method achieves a better F1 score than baseline models on real-world data sets.

HyperHatePrompt: A Hypergraph-based Prompting Fusion Model for Multimodal Hate Detection (2025.coling-main)

Copied to clipboard

Challenge: Existing models for multimodal hate detection lack implicit hateful cues, cross-modal-induced hate, and diversity of hate target groups.
Approach: They propose a hypergraph-based prompting fusion model that uses LLMs to generate hate cue prompts and hypergraph learning to merge multimodal hate features.
Outcome: The proposed model outperforms state-of-the-art models on two benchmark datasets showing that it can detect hate content across multiple modalities.

Improve Meta-learning for Few-Shot Text Classification with All You Can Acquire from the Tasks (2024.findings-emnlp)

Copied to clipboard

Challenge: Existing methods for few-shot text classification often encounter problems drawing accurate class prototypes from support set samples.
Approach: They propose a meta-learning method that leverages the information within the task itself . they propose Query-Data-Augmenter and Label-Adapter to build a task-adaptive metric space .
Outcome: The proposed method shows obvious advantages over state-of-the-art models on eight benchmark datasets.

Unveiling Opinion Evolution via Prompting and Diffusion for Short Video Fake News Detection (2024.findings-acl)

Copied to clipboard

Challenge: Existing methods for short video fake news detection ignore the implicit opinions and evolving nature of opinions across modalities.
Approach: They propose a short video fake news model that mines implicit opinions within short videos and promotes the evolution of both explicit and implicit opinions across all modalities.
Outcome: The proposed model outperforms existing methods on a publicly available dataset for short video fake news detection.
